Selling a Fort Wayne Home thru Social Media

Disclaimer: This is about selling my own home and information can be found at http://FortWayneHomeforSalebyOwner.com.

I feel somewhat challenged to use predominately Social Media, the web and a 28 day plan in selling our Fort Wayne home. Yes, I do have yard sign.

Home for SaleI have always discussed that people that talk the talk should walk the walk. Last year I did a blog post  Hiring a consultant, can I see your marketing plan?, that referred to this idea.  I have always been dead serious about this requirement, it really is not an option to me. So, I have taking it upon myself to sell a house primarily through social media, the web and more importantly I am following a Value Stream Marketing Concept that includes:

First thing that we did was develop a 28-day plan. We broke it down into user stories and than into 4 – 1 week scheduled iterations much like the Agile or Scrum practices that I use. I developed a Marketing Kanban board for the occasion which I think will prove quite interesting for the whole process.

One of the initial steps or iterations we did was to include a Home Staging Release to promote the Interior Design store, Wild Hare Decor (another disclaimer – it is my wife’s store). Of course, we did other things; listed on Craig’s list, scheduled a pre-moving sale, an open house and blogged about it on several sites. I think it should be a lot of fun and a true learning experience.

I am very interested in sharing this process as it takes place. It is always one thing talking the talk, it is another Walking the walk.
